# JAME Dataset **JAME** (JAM Evaluation) is a comprehensive music dataset containing 250 high-quality music tracks designed for **standardized evaluation of song generation models**. This dataset is part of **Project Jamify** developed by [DeCLaRe Lab](https://github.com/declare-lab/jamify/tree/main) and supports research in controllable music generation. ## Dataset Overview - **Total Tracks**: 250 carefully curated tracks (50 per genre, 5 genres total) - **Duration**: Approximately 230 seconds per track - **Genres**: Hip-Hop/Rap, Rock/Metal, Electronic/Dance, R&B/Soul/Jazz, Country/Folk - **Release Time**: select tracks released after 1st May 2025 to avoid data contaimination. - **Purpose**: Standardized evaluation benchmark for song generation models ## Dataset Structure ``` jame/ ├── README.md # This file ├── metadata.jsonl # Complete metadata for all tracks ├── spotify_urls.txt # Plain text list of Spotify URLs ├── transcriptions/ # JSON transcription files │ ├── Artist - Title.json │ └── ... └── struct/ # JSON structure analysis files ├── Artist - Title.json └── ... ``` ## Audio Access Audio files are not directly provided in this dataset. Users can legally access the audio through: - **Spotify**: Using the provided `spotify_url` links - **YouTube Music**: Using the provided `youtube_url` links - **Legal Streaming Services**: Search by artist and title information Please ensure compliance with terms of service and copyright laws when accessing audio content. ## Metadata Format Each line in `metadata.jsonl` contains a JSON object with the following fields: ```json { "file_name": "Artist - Title", "artist": "Artist Name", "title": "Song Title", "spotify_url": "https://open.spotify.com/track/...", "youtube_url": "https://music.youtube.com/watch?v=...", "duration": 180, "year": 2025, "genre": "Hip-Hop/Rap", "transcription_path": "transcriptions/Artist - Title.json", "struct_path": "struct/Artist - Title.json", "song_id": "spotify_track_id" } ``` ### Field Descriptions - **file_name**: Base filename without extension - **artist**: Primary artist name - **title**: Song title - **spotify_url**: Official Spotify track URL - **youtube_url**: YouTube Music URL - **duration**: Track duration in seconds - **year**: Release year - **genre**: Music genre category - **transcription_path**: Path to transcription JSON file - **struct_path**: Path to structure analysis JSON file - **song_id**: Spotify track identifier ## Genre Distribution The dataset contains 250 tracks evenly distributed across 5 genres (50 tracks per genre): - **Hip-Hop/Rap** (50 tracks): Urban and rap music - **Rock/Metal** (50 tracks): Rock, alternative, and metal tracks - **Electronic/Dance** (50 tracks): Electronic, EDM, and dance music - **R&B/Soul/Jazz** (50 tracks): R&B, soul, and jazz-influenced tracks - **Country/Folk** (50 tracks): Country, folk, and acoustic music ## File Formats - **Metadata**: JSONL (JSON Lines) format with complete track information - **Transcriptions**: JSON format with detailed transcription data - **Structure**: JSON format with musical structure annotations - **URLs**: Plain text file with Spotify URLs for easy access ## License and Attribution Please ensure proper attribution when using this dataset.
